What Are Roman Blinds?

Roman blinds are folded and are a fabric window covering in soft horizontal layers when raised. On reducing them, they form a smooth, customized panel which gives a room its warmth and texture.

They usually are constructed of cotton, linen, polyester blends, blackout fabrics, and patterned textiles. This makes them an excellent option for those homeowners who desire window coverings that are not only functional but also ornamental.

Roman blinds are popular because they:

  • Offer a delicate and classy feel.
  • Have a wide range of fabrics, colours, and designs.
  • Offer a cozy layered look.
  • Provide good privacy.

They are particularly effective in living rooms, bedrooms, dining rooms, and formal areas. Roman blinds can also make a gorgeous focal point in case your interior style is traditional, transitional, classic, or cozy.

Furthermore, they are also an intelligent choice of window blinds for Canadian homes where a sense of warmth, softness, and comfort are the major design factors.

What Are Roller Blinds?

Roller blinds are made from a single sheet of fabric that rolls up or down around a tube. They are designed in a simple, clean, and highly practical style, making them one of the most popular modern window treatment options.

Typical roller blind types include blackout roller blinds, light-filtering blinds, solar screen fabrics, and privacy fabrics, each serving a different purpose depending on the level of light control and privacy required.

Roller blinds are known for:

  • Modern, minimal lines.
  • Ease of use.
  • Low maintenance.
  • Strong durability.
  • Good affordability.

They are also suitable for kitchens, bathrooms, offices, condos, rental properties, and minimalist interiors. Since they sit close to the window, roller blinds are especially practical for small rooms and tight spaces where a clean, space-saving solution is needed. 

Roller blinds are commonly the less difficult option when a clean appearance and a straightforward everyday usage are preferred.

Roman Vs Roller Blinds: Key Comparisons

In choosing the two styles above, consider more than just appearance. Consider how each of the blind will do in your everyday life.

1. Appearance and Style

Roman blinds are attractive, layered, and soft. They enhance the beauty of a space and go well with traditional interiors, carpets, and furniture.

Roller blinds are more streamlined. They are applicable in contemporary, Scandinavian, industrial, and minimalist areas. Their profile is clean, enabling the window to be integrated in the room rather than being the primary focus.

Select Roman blinds if you desire classiness, and go for roller blinds if you’re looking for simplicity.

2. Light Control and Privacy

Roman blinds provide a moderate level of light control. The end product will be determined by the material you choose. The light-filtering fabric lightens sunlight, and the blackout fabric enhances the darkening of the room.

Roller blinds provide you with a more precise choice of light-control options. You may select sheer or light-filtering, sunscreen, privacy, or complete blackout materials.

In media rooms, nurseries, and bedrooms, blackout roller blinds could provide better performance. Roman blinds may be used to have a gentler light in the living rooms and lounges.

3. Maintenance and Durability

Roman blinds require greater attention as they are made of folded cloth. Dust might be trapped in the pleats, and there are those fabrics that might require cleaning by a professional.

Roller blinds are less difficult to maintain. The majority can be cleaned by a soft cloth or slightly vacuumed. This qualifies them as a good choice in high-traffic places like kitchens, bathrooms, and home offices.

Roller blinds have an advantage if the most important factor to you is low maintenance.

4. Cost Considerations

Roman blinds tend to be more expensive since more fabric is required, more detailed construction, and often a more customized finish is needed. High-quality fabrics and blacks’ outs can also add to the cost.

Roller blinds are also typically cheaper. They consume less cloth and are offered in numerous cost brackets.

5. Installation and Space Requirements

Roman blinds require sufficient space to stack neatly when raised. Because of their fabric folds, they may take up more room at the top, which can slightly reduce the amount of visible glass, especially on smaller windows.

In terms of installation, Roman blinds are usually fitted inside the window frame or mounted above it, and they may require more precise measuring for a clean, tailored finish.

Roller blinds, on the other hand, are compact and space-efficient. They are easier to install and can be fitted inside or outside the window frame with minimal effort. This makes them ideal for small windows, narrow frames, and modern constructions where a simple and neat installation is preferred.

When to Choose Roman Blinds

Roman blinds are the right choice when you want a soft, stylish, and more furnished look for your home.

Select Roman blinds when:

  • Your room has a traditional or elegant décor theme.
  • You prefer a warm fabric texture and cozy appearance.
  • You are decorating a bedroom, dining room, or living room.
  • You want the blinds to act as a decorative feature.
  • You prefer softer alternatives to hard window coverings.

They also work beautifully when paired with curtains or side panels, creating a layered and high-end interior look.

When to Choose Roller Blinds

Roller blinds are ideal when you need functionality, simplicity, and ease of use.

Select roller blinds when:

  • Your home style is modern or minimalistic.
  • You need blinds for kitchens, bathrooms, or offices.
  • You are looking for an affordable window covering option.
  • You have small or narrow windows.
  • You prefer easy cleaning and low maintenance.
  • You need blackout or solar screen functionality.

Roller blinds are especially convenient for busy households that want a clean, practical look without the need for frequent maintenance.

Additional Options: Motorized and Smart Blinds

Both Roller and Roman blinds can be motorized. Motorized blinds would be the best fit in large windows, tall windows, difficult-to-access places, and smart homes.

They have a number of advantages:

  • Remote or application control.
  • Voice assistant compatibility.
  • Improved child and pet safety.
  • Planned opening and closing.
  • More presentable appearance with fewer controls visible.

When modern window blinds are required in Canadian homes, motorized solutions can also be considered to help manage glare, privacy, and indoor comfort as the seasons change throughout the year.

FAQs

1. Do Roman blinds cost more than roller blinds?

Yes, Roman blinds are generally more expensive than roller blinds because they require more fabric and involve a more complex construction process.

2. Can roller blinds be motorized?

Yes. Motorized roller blinds can be controlled remotely, via a wall switch, mobile app, or smart home system.

3. What is the best blind for small windows?

Roller blinds are usually better for small windows as they are compact and do not take up much space when raised.

4. How do I maintain Roman blinds?

Use a vacuum with a brush attachment or a soft cloth to dust them regularly. Some fabrics may require spot cleaning or professional dry cleaning.

5. Do Roman blinds offer blackout options?

Yes, Roman blinds can provide effective room darkening when made with blackout fabric or blackout lining.
